If you are new to painting outdoors and want to know what to bring see my list of suggestions below:
camp chair, water, sunscreen, bug spray, hat, snacks/drinks
Chalk pastels are the easiest to start with and have great portability. I recommend a set of 24, Strathmore multimedia sketchbook and some cotton swabs and some wet wipes. A music stand makes for a very inexpensive and portable easel.
